Evaluating RPA Bot Automation for Scalable Operations

RPA bot automation functions by mimicking human interactions with digital systems to execute high-volume, rule-based tasks. Unlike manual operations, which are bound by employee fatigue and resource limitations, bots provide 24/7 consistency. Key components include interface interaction, data extraction, and rule-based decision-making. By offloading these burdens, enterprises eliminate bottlenecks that historically throttled growth.

The business impact is significant. Automation delivers immediate reduction in operational costs while reallocating human capital toward strategic initiatives. Enterprise leaders should focus on automating tasks with structured data input to achieve rapid ROI. A practical insight is to prioritize processes that require high frequency but low complexity, as these provide the most immediate performance gains.

The Hidden Costs of Maintaining Manual Operations

Manual operations rely heavily on human bandwidth, creating a ceiling for productivity. As transaction volumes rise, the cost of scaling manual teams grows linearly, often leading to increased error rates and compliance risks. Effective operations teams recognize that relying on legacy manual methods limits an enterprise’s ability to pivot during market volatility.

When organizations rely on manual workflows, they face higher training costs and slower turnaround times. Transitioning to automated systems mitigates these operational risks while ensuring data integrity. Leaders must view automation as a tool to augment the workforce rather than replace it. A critical implementation insight involves auditing existing bottlenecks to identify which manual workflows currently produce the highest rate of data entry errors.

Key Challenges

Common hurdles include resistance to change and poorly defined process documentation. Successful transitions require clear communication and rigorous process mapping before deployment.

Best Practices

Start with small, high-impact pilot projects. Scale automation gradually after validating performance metrics and ensuring alignment with broader IT objectives.

Governance Alignment

Ensure all bots comply with internal IT security policies and data privacy regulations. Robust IT governance is the cornerstone of sustainable automation maturity.

Q: Does RPA require replacing existing legacy software?

A: No, RPA is designed to act as a layer on top of your existing applications, allowing it to work with legacy systems without requiring a complete overhaul.

Q: How does RPA impact long-term employee engagement?

A: RPA boosts engagement by removing tedious, repetitive tasks from employee workloads, allowing staff to focus on high-value, creative, and strategic problem-solving.
